Output fbbbaac93621611a3acc53cac656033b6cf6136c13911711d8b44c295ab93bdd:0

value
6097423
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cab3a28b4e4b46850e4d6f95d3d9d1e8a6c3fe7e OP_EQUAL
address
3LAocYj6FvbjmdY4CkVkh38ieFNfPbrGcM
transaction
fbbbaac93621611a3acc53cac656033b6cf6136c13911711d8b44c295ab93bdd
confirmations
296647
spent
true